Client: First Call – Alcohol/Drug Prevention & Recovery

Challenge:

Event Fundraising for three very different types of events throughout the year:

  • The Gratitude Luncheon is a community recognition event, celebrating those working hard in the field of advocacy and recovery. This event creates high-level stature for First Call as the leading agency, acknowledging the work of its peers.
  • The Celebrity Golf Tournament cultivates community through its corporate sponsorships and offers the opportunity to give and play at the same time.
  • The Celebration Dinner creates the space to provide education through keynote presentations and testimonials and fosters individual giving from each attendee sitting at fully sponsored tables.

Results: 

All three major events were sold out for the first time in the history of the organization. We doubled the number of sponsorships by bringing new corporations to the table. We were able to then initiate an “Annual Sponsorship Package” that would enable companies to commit to all three annual events as a sponsor.

Having sponsorship money already committed as committees geared up for each event helped to stimulate ideas for new sponsors and invigorated committee engagement.

At the end of the year, net revenue doubled from these fundraising events.
